Liza needs a total of 22.23 square feet of cloth to make a bag and a towel the bag requires 5.13 square feet of cloth the height of the towel is three feet what is the length of towel

Answer:

5.7 feet

Explanation:

Total cloth area recquired to make a bag and a towel is 22.23 square feet

Given the area of the cloth recquired to make the bag is 5.13 square feet.

The area of cloth recquired to make the towel is = 22.23-5.13=17.1 square feet

given the height of the towel = 3 feet

let the length of the towel be x

We know that
area = length* height

area=3x


3x=17.1\\x=5.7

therefore the length of the towel is 5.7 feet
